Role Purpose
The Associate Director Employee Relations Governance provides strategic leadership in shaping and governing the Organisation's employee and labour relations framework.
This role leads the development of policies, advisory standards, case governance and analytics to ensure fair, consistent and legally sound people practices. The incumbent partners closely with HR leadership, Legal, Risk, unions, and government agencies to manage complex disciplinary matters, labour relations issues and emerging workforce risks.
The role combines deep industrial relationships expertise, policy leadership, stakeholder influence, and data-driven decision making, and serves as a subject-matter authority on employment legislation and industrial relations strategy.
